Other highlights from our hike to the summit of Saddle Mountain...

On the trail. You can see how steep the hillside is. There was a lot of switchbacking and you have to be very careful in many spots because, if you fall, there's nothing to stop you.

Some type of Indian Paintbrush. There were a lot of wildflowers just starting to bloom all over the mountain. Unfortunately, it was much too windy, misty and just plain yucky for me to take photos.

I was beyond exhausted already when we stumbled across this mile marker. An hour into our hike, one mile down, one and a half more to go to the summit, plus 2.5 back down to the car still. I believe my exact words were, "That's it? You've got to be *bleep*ing kidding me!"

I spotted this guy crossing the trail on the way back down. That's my foot for reference. Bear in mind I have tiny feet. This was the biggest slug I've ever seen. He was a good 6-7" long. Ick!
